Why Do My Pipes Make Noises
To detect noisy plumbing, it is very important to determine initial whether the undesirable sounds take place on the system's inlet side-in various other words, when water is turned on-or on the drainpipe side. Noises on the inlet side have differed causes: too much water pressure, used valve and also faucet components, improperly attached pumps or other home appliances, incorrectly put pipeline fasteners, and also plumbing runs containing a lot of limited bends or other restrictions. Noises on the drainpipe side normally stem from bad area or, as with some inlet side noise, a layout having tight bends.

Hissing


Hissing sound that occurs when a tap is opened slightly normally signals excessive water pressure. Consult your neighborhood water company if you presume this trouble; it will be able to inform you the water stress in your area and can set up a pressurereducing shutoff on the inbound water supply pipe if needed.

Various Other Inlet Side Noises


Squeaking, squealing, damaging, breaking, and also touching generally are caused by the expansion or tightening of pipelines, typically copper ones providing hot water. The noises take place as the pipelines slide versus loose fasteners or strike close-by home framework. You can often pinpoint the location of the issue if the pipes are subjected; just comply with the noise when the pipes are making noise. Probably you will find a loose pipe hanger or an area where pipes exist so near to flooring joists or various other mounting items that they clatter against them. Attaching foam pipe insulation around the pipes at the point of contact need to fix the trouble. Make sure bands and hangers are safe and secure and supply adequate support. Where possible, pipeline bolts should be connected to massive structural aspects such as structure wall surfaces as opposed to to mounting; doing so lessens the transmission of vibrations from plumbing to surfaces that can amplify and also move them. If connecting fasteners to framework is inescapable, wrap pipes with insulation or various other durable material where they contact bolts, and sandwich completions of new bolts between rubber washers when installing them.
Dealing with plumbing runs that struggle with flow-restricting tight or many bends is a last resort that ought to be embarked on just after consulting a competent plumbing specialist. However, this scenario is rather usual in older residences that might not have actually been developed with interior plumbing or that have actually seen a number of remodels, especially by novices.

Babbling or Shrilling


Extreme chattering or shrilling that happens when a shutoff or tap is activated, and that generally goes away when the installation is opened fully, signals loose or defective internal components. The remedy is to change the shutoff or faucet with a new one.
Pumps and appliances such as cleaning equipments and also dishwashing machines can transfer motor sound to pipelines if they are incorrectly connected. Connect such products to plumbing with plastic or rubber hoses-never rigid pipe-to isolate them.

Drain Sound


On the drain side of plumbing, the principal goals are to remove surface areas that can be struck by falling or hurrying water and to protect pipelines to contain inevitable audios.
In brand-new building, tubs, shower stalls, commodes, and wallmounted sinks and basins must be set on or versus resistant underlayments to lower the transmission of sound through them. Water-saving commodes and also taps are much less loud than standard models; mount them as opposed to older kinds even if codes in your location still permit using older fixtures.
Drainpipes that do not run up and down to the basement or that branch right into straight pipe runs supported at floor joists or various other framing existing specifically problematic sound troubles. Such pipelines are huge sufficient to radiate considerable vibration; they also carry significant quantities of water, that makes the scenario even worse. In new building, specify cast-iron soil pipelines (the huge pipes that drain toilets) if you can manage them. Their massiveness includes much of the sound made by water going through them. Also, stay clear of directing drainpipes in wall surfaces shown bedrooms as well as rooms where individuals gather. Wall surfaces having drainpipes must be soundproofed as was defined earlier, utilizing dual panels of sound-insulating fiber board and wallboard. Pipes themselves can be wrapped with unique fiberglass insulation created the purpose; such pipes have an impervious vinyl skin (often having lead). Outcomes are not constantly satisfying.

Thudding


Thudding noise, typically accompanied by shivering pipelines, when a faucet or device valve is switched off is a condition called water hammer. The noise as well as resonance are triggered by the resounding wave of stress in the water, which instantly has no area to go. Sometimes opening a valve that discharges water swiftly into an area of piping including a limitation, elbow, or tee fitting can produce the exact same condition.
Water hammer can usually be healed by installing installations called air chambers or shock absorbers in the plumbing to which the problem shutoffs or faucets are attached. These tools allow the shock wave developed by the halted circulation of water to dissipate in the air they have, which (unlike water) is compressible.
Older plumbing systems might have short upright areas of capped pipe behind wall surfaces on faucet runs for the very same purpose; these can at some point fill with water, minimizing or destroying their efficiency. The treatment is to drain pipes the water system totally by shutting down the main water supply shutoff and opening all taps. After that open up the main supply valve as well as shut the faucets one at a time, starting with the faucet nearest the valve and finishing with the one farthest away.

WHY IS MY PLUMBING MAKING SO MUCH NOISE?


This noise indeed sounds like someone is banging a hammer against your pipes! It happens when a faucet is opened, allowed to run for a bit, then quickly shut — causing the rushing water to slam against the shut-off valve.



To remedy this, you’ll need to check and refill your air chamber. Air chambers are filled with — you guessed it — air and help absorb the shock of moving water (that comes to a sudden stop). Over time, these chambers can fill with water, making them less effective.

Cracks or Ticks


Cracking or ticking typically comes from hot water going through cold, copper pipes. This causes the copper to expand resulting in a cracking or ticking sound. Once the pipes stop expanding, the noise should stop as well.



Pro tip: you may want to lower the temperature of your water heater to see if that helps lessen the sound, or wrapping the pipe in insulation can also help muffle the noise.


Bangs


Bangs typically come from water pressure that’s too high. To test for high water pressure, get a pressure gauge and attach it to your faucet. Water pressure should be no higher than 80 psi (pounds per square inch) and also no lower than 40 psi. If you find a number greater than 80 psi, then you’ve found your problem!
